On February 25-26, in the Guria region - in the municipalities of Ozurgeti, Chokhatauri and Lanchkhuti, emergency doctors were on 81 calls. 44 people were provided with medical assistance on the spot, 30 people were hospitalized, including citizens who require various specific medical assistance.
Rural doctors are actively involved in the process, providing telephone consultations to citizens, and medicines are also being delivered to them on the spot.
In connection with the heavy snowfall in Western Georgia, a coordination headquarters has been created to deal with the consequences of the disaster, rescue teams of the Ministry of Internal Affairs have been mobilized, defense forces are involved, and more than 200 emergency teams have been mobilized.
